Xu Huan-fen, Liu Wei, Xie Yue-shan. Fireworks Algorithm Based on Dual Population for Optimization ProblemsJ. Journal of Guangdong University of Technology, 2017, 34(5): 65-72. DOI: 10.12052/gdutxb.160124
    Citation: Xu Huan-fen, Liu Wei, Xie Yue-shan. Fireworks Algorithm Based on Dual Population for Optimization ProblemsJ. Journal of Guangdong University of Technology, 2017, 34(5): 65-72. DOI: 10.12052/gdutxb.160124

    Fireworks Algorithm Based on Dual Population for Optimization Problems

    • A fireworks algorithm based on dual population is proposed to solve optimization problems. A dual population strategy is used to amend the shortcomings, i.e. slow convergence and bad population diversity of the existing fireworks algorithms. Each of two populations is running independently. Meanwhile, they alternately perform the hill-climbing and collaborative operator during the evolution process. Therein, the hill-climbing operator can enhance the local search performance of the proposed algorithm. And the collaborative operator is utilized to maintain the population diversity, avoiding getting stuck in local optimal regions. Furthermore, the proposed algorithm improves the setting of the maximum amplitude of the explosion and uses the tournament selection strategy to improve the convergence rate. The experimental results indicate that the proposed algorithm is superior to the compared algorithms in terms of the stabilization and reliability for most of test problems. It has higher accuracy lever and faster convergence rate.
    • loading

    Catalog

      Turn off MathJax
      Article Contents

      /

      DownLoad:  Full-Size Img  PowerPoint
      Return
      Return